Tomberlin pulses but won't go
 
All,

I have a 2010 Tomerblin which I love and it has been running great. Yesterday my wife and kids headed to the course and about 100 yards from the house it stopped going and would not resume. The cart will pulse a little like it's starting to move in forward and reverse but that is it. Batteries are within two years old and I keep them charged and topped off with water. Charger shows full charge and no issues. I've got the maintenance manual and plan to start troubleshooting this thing but was wondering if anyone has had this issue before. My guess is you have one or more brushes stuck, a very common problem with Tomberlins. After it happens again remove the rubber plug on the black box/ controller cover and see if there is an yellow error code blinking, I will be 2 series of blinks. If it blinks once, then 3 times, and your cart is "pulsing" I can almost guarantee stuck brushes.
Having said all that, you could also have one battery falling on its face, which wouldn't show up on your dash indicator, you need to jack up the rear end and run the cart while checking each battery individually to see, checking the batteries without some kind of load on them won't do you any good.

Sounds to me like you have a shorted battery. Checking them under a load will determine if you have one bad.

Stuck brushes which is common. will be an issue after the cart has sat. If it was running and petered out, battery would be the most likely culprit.
